When estimating the cost to hire a Magento development company in the UK, it is important to understand the two primary Magento editions:
Magento Open Source
This version is free to use and suitable for small to medium sized businesses. Development costs are still significant because customization, hosting, security, and maintenance are required.
Adobe Commerce
Previously known as Magento Commerce, this is the paid enterprise version. Licensing costs alone can range from thousands to tens of thousands of pounds annually. It offers advanced features such as AI driven personalization, advanced analytics, and enhanced B2B functionality.
The edition you choose directly impacts development cost, ongoing expenses, and the type of Magento development company you need to hire.

For clearly defined projects, many UK Magento agencies offer fixed price models.
Basic Magento store development
£8,000 to £15,000
Suitable for simple stores with limited customization
Custom Magento development
£15,000 to £40,000
Includes custom themes, extensions, and integrations
Enterprise Magento solutions
£40,000 to £100,000 or more
Designed for high traffic, multi store, or B2B ecommerce platforms

Many businesses consider offshore development to reduce costs. While offshore rates may appear attractive, there are important trade offs.
Offshore Magento developers may charge £20 to £40 per hour. UK developers charge significantly more.
In many cases, the initial cost savings are offset by rework, delays, and long term maintenance issues.
Magento development companies in the UK typically offer several engagement models.
Best for projects with clearly defined requirements. Provides cost certainty but limited flexibility.
Suitable for evolving projects. You pay for actual hours worked. Offers flexibility but requires careful project management.
You hire a dedicated Magento team on a monthly basis. Costs range from £6,000 to £15,000 per month depending on team size and expertise.
This model is ideal for long term ecommerce growth and continuous development.

This includes installation, configuration, theme setup, and basic functionality. Costs typically range from £10,000 to £20,000.
Custom theme development costs range from £3,000 to £10,000 depending on complexity.
Custom extension development costs between £1,500 and £8,000 per extension.
Migration costs depend on data volume and complexity, ranging from £5,000 to £25,000.
Hiring in house Magento developers involves additional costs such as salaries, benefits, training, and infrastructure.
Magento developers in the UK earn between £45,000 and £80,000 annually. Building a full team significantly increases overhead.
A Magento development company offers instant access to a complete team without long term employment commitments.
